Do you have a child just starting to read? These 12 sight word games and activities are the perfect way to help them learn while having a good time!

Sight Word Games Blog Image

Sight word games and activities can make beginning reading fun and help your child build a strong foundation they will use forever!

Forget the flash cards, let kids trace words in sand. This will help stimulate your little ones as they get to feel and touch the texture of the sand as they learn!

sight word target practice

Use a soft ball to aim and hit the sight words you can read! Kids will love getting to throw the ball in the house. HUGE incentive to read the words fast!

sight word cups

Move cups around, guess sight words and try to figure out where the toy is hiding! Super fun game that will keep kids guessing.
